The Diploma in Engineering is designed to engage students in, and further prepare students for, tertiary study in Engineering / Engineering Science and in so doing address any perceived deficiencies in the students’ mathematical and physics knowledge and skills. The Diploma presents students with units from the first year of the Bachelor of Engineering (Honours) or Bachelor of Engineering Science degree and aims to produce students who are fully prepared for study beyond the first year of the Bachelor of Engineering (Honours) / Engineering Science degree. It is completed in a smaller, more supportive learning environment than usually found in first year undergraduate programs, is designed to develop students to have greater ability in self-directed study and have the self-esteem that comes from prior achievement in a tertiary environment. The inclusion of additional preparatory units is designed to assist students in the transition to study at University level.

Study Mode
One and a half years full-time (four terms) or three years part-time (eight terms). Students will be required to attend the Kingswood or Parramatta South campus for some learning experiences.

Admission

Local Recent School Leavers

Completion of Year 12 with specified ATAR to be determined year by year.

International Students

IELTS 5.5 with minimum 5.0 in each sub band; or equivalent results from either the English Language Program or English Entrance Test administered by Western Sydney University, The College.and completion of year 11 or equivalent with specified results.

Non-Credentialed Students

Australian Citizens and Permanent Residents either aged 18 years or over or completed Year 11 equivalent.
